Four months after the beginning of the protest movement, while the economic situation has continued to deteriorate,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i has tried to reassure the population by presenting a draft budget for the year starting on March 21 , with a focus on fighting inflation and defending the Iranian currency.

"

Improving people's livelihoods, controlling inflation, reducing state spending, economic growth and employment

" are the priorities of the budget, the Iranian president told the deputies.

The Iranian economy, affected by US

sanctions since 2018

, is plunged into a serious crisis with official inflation exceeding 46% while that of everyday consumer products reaches 70%.

The protests of recent months have further aggravated the situation.

Since September, the Iranian currency has lost more than 30% of its value, which has a direct effect on all products.

The pessimistic economists

The new sanctions imposed against Iran by the United States and

European countries

since the start of the protest movement have further aggravated the situation.

But the president wanted to be reassuring, assuring that the Iranian economy had reached a growth of 4% after several years of negative figures.

According to official figures, Iran managed to increase its oil exports to a level of 1.4 barrels of oil per day.

However, economists predict even more difficult months with the continuation of inflation and the continued decline in the value of the currency against the dollar.
